The utility model relates to the technical field of blood purification, in particular to a fixing bracket of a blood purifier.
Background
Blood purification is also known as dialysis in daily life. The meaning of the method is as follows: the blood of the patient is led out of the body and passed through a purifying device to remove some pathogenic substances and purify the blood, so as to achieve the goal of curing diseases. Blood purification should include: hemodialysis, hemofiltration, hemodiafiltration, plasmapheresis, immunoadsorption, and the like. Peritoneal dialysis is based on the same principle, although it does not draw blood out of the body. Hemodialysis is only one of the methods of treating chronic renal failure. The semi-permeable membrane principle is utilized, and the purposes of purifying blood and correcting water electrolyte and acid-base balance are achieved by diffusion, various harmful and redundant metabolic wastes in fluid and excessive electrolytes moving out of the body.
The fixing frame of the nephrology department therapeutic blood purifier disclosed in the Chinese patent application publication No. CN214512098U, although the fixing frame can comb the medical hose and the infusion tube respectively by the fixing clamp ring on the pipeline platform, the medical hose and the infusion tube are clamped and fixed by the movable clamp ring, and the problem that the pipeline is deformed and blocked due to entanglement deformation easily caused by excessive medical hose and infusion tube used on the blood purifier is avoided.
However, this fixing frame of nephrology department treatment blood purifier when blood purifier removes, can not tie up tightly fixedly to blood purifier, stability is relatively poor, can not adjust height and angle simultaneously, shortcoming that space utilization is low.

The upper surface of therotary sleeve 4 is fixedly connected with across brace 5, the surface of thecross brace 5 is fixedly connected with afixed ring 6, the surface of thefixed ring 6 is fixedly connected with afixed plate 7, the surface of thefixed plate 7 is slidably connected with asliding plate 8, the surface of thesliding plate 8 is fixedly connected with a supportingplate 9, the surface of thefixed plate 7 is in threaded connection with atelescopic ring assembly 10, through the arrangement of thetelescopic ring assembly 10 and the supportingplate 9, therotary column 1004 is screwed, so that thetelescopic ring assembly 10 is fixed on thefixed plate 7, the blood purifier is placed in thetelescopic ring assembly 10, thetelescopic column 1003 is screwed, the blood purifier is fixed in thetelescopic ring assembly 10, thesliding plate 8 is pulled to a proper position, the height of the supportingplate 9 is driven to be adjusted, thelimiting column 303 is screwed, the bottom of the blood purifier is fixedly placed on the supportingplate 9, and therefore the fixing function is increased, and the stability of the fixing bracket is enhanced;
thelifting assembly 3 comprises afixed rod 301, asliding rod 302 and alimiting column 303, wherein thesliding rod 302 is connected inside thefixed rod 301 in a sliding manner, a limiting hole is formed in the surface of thesliding rod 302, and thelimiting column 303 is connected with the surface of the limiting hole in a threaded manner;
the surface of therotary sleeve 4 is provided with a threaded hole, and the surface of the threaded hole is in threaded connection with a threadedcolumn 11;
the surface of thefixed plate 7 is provided with a connecting hole, and the inside of the connecting hole is connected with a connectingcolumn 12 through threads;
the surface of the supportingplate 9 is provided with a supporting groove, and the surface of the supporting groove is fixedly connected with arubber pad 13;
thetelescopic ring assembly 10 comprises a firsttelescopic ring 1001, a secondtelescopic ring 1002, atelescopic column 1003 and arotary column 1004, wherein the outer surface of the firsttelescopic ring 1001 is rotationally connected with the secondtelescopic ring 1002, a sliding hole is formed in the surface of the firsttelescopic ring 1001, a telescopic threaded hole is formed in the surface of the secondtelescopic ring 1002, thetelescopic column 1003 is connected with the surface of the telescopic threaded hole in a threaded mode, the sliding hole is formed in the outer surface of the secondtelescopic ring 1002, and therotary column 1004 is connected with the surface of the sliding hole in a sliding mode.
